Chester Greenwood was an avid ice skater who lived in Maine. He found it difficult to keep his ears warm while skating and needed something to shield his ears from the bitter cold.
He created two circular hoops from wire and covered them in beaver fur and velvet. They were connected by a steel band, which served as a headband.
